Summary

All-wheel drive is now standard and although the Nautilus is no longer offered with a turbocharged V6, Lincoln gives drivers the option of a hybrid powerplant with plenty of driving range. Also new this year is some seriously cool tech including a full-width display and Blue Cruise hands-free driving.

Verdict: Luxurious and laden with value, the new Lincoln Nautilus looks like a compelling option alongside pricier German alternatives. In particular, the available hybrid powertrain and impressive technology makes this luxury two-row crossover a standout in its class.

The Toyota Sequoia gained a standard hybrid powertrain when it entered its third generation, just last year. While the tech updates were widely celebrated and the facelift considered unobjectionable even by its harshest critics, the move to hybrid power proved to be something of a mixed bag. Increased towing and hauling power bolstered the obvious advantage of improved fuel economy, but impact was somewhat dampened by the reduction in cargo and third-row space to accommodate the new battery.

Verdict: The Sequoia may not be the most capable full-size SUV in the segment, and it’s certainly not the most spacious. It is, however, the only hybrid in its class, and it offers a blend of seating capacity, towing power, and fuel efficiency you won’t find elsewhere—at least, not if you don’t want to go diesel.

Look and feel

2024 Lincoln Nautilus

9/10

2024 Toyota Sequoia

7/10

The 2024 Lincoln Nautilus, available exclusively in Reserve trim in Canada, showcased a sophisticated and streamlined exterior design, hinting at a new direction for Lincoln. Its grille, reminiscent of Mercedes-Benz's bifurcated design, featured LED lighting that extended through the grille, illuminating the Lincoln star logo. The rear mirrored this horizontal aesthetic with a full-width animated LED light bar and dual exhaust ports. The interior was the highlight, with a full-width screen as its crown jewel. The materials used were of excellent quality, featuring ambient lighting, open-pore wood, and fine leather. The piano key shifter style, a Lincoln tradition since the mid-1950s, was a notable design element. An optional Jet Appearance Package added two-tone paint, black exterior trim, 22-inch wheels, and unique interior bits for an additional $3,750.

The 2024 Toyota Sequoia shared its platform and several design cues with the Tundra pickup, including hexagonal grilles and muscular stances. The exterior colour significantly influenced its appearance, with the Capstone model featuring more chrome brightwork. Inside, the Sequoia closely resembled the Tundra and other contemporary Toyota vehicles, with a blocky, geometric dash layout and physical dials and buttons for climate control. The Capstone trim featured semi-aniline leather upholstery, while SofTex leatherette and leather were standard on lower trims. The Sequoia offered power-adjustable front seats across the lineup and a power-tilt and -slide moonroof. The interior was spacious, with a focus on practicality and comfort, although the design felt somewhat dated.

Performance

2024 Lincoln Nautilus

7/10

2024 Toyota Sequoia

8/10

The 2024 Lincoln Nautilus came standard with a turbocharged four-cylinder engine producing 250 horsepower and 280 pound-feet of torque, paired with an eight-speed automatic transmission. The power delivery was smooth, and shifts were subtle. For an additional $3,500, buyers could opt for a hybrid setup, increasing output to 310 horsepower and 295 lb-ft of torque, with a fuel economy of 7.7 litres per 100 kilometres in combined driving. The hybrid offered a range of over 950 kilometres. All Nautilus models featured all-wheel drive and five drive modes, with an adaptive suspension available for enhanced performance. The hybrid's continuously variable transmission (CVT) was well-tuned, avoiding the typical droning associated with CVTs.

The 2024 Toyota Sequoia was offered exclusively in hybrid format, utilizing Toyota's iForce MAX hybrid powertrain. This setup combined a twin-turbo V6 engine with an electric motor, delivering 427 horsepower and 583 lb-ft of torque. The Sequoia's fuel economy improved to 11.7 L/100 km combined with four-wheel drive. Standard 4WD included a selector for 4Hi, 4Lo, and 2WD. The 10-speed automatic transmission operated smoothly, and the Sequoia's on-road handling was adequate for its class. The SR5 TRD Off-Road model offered adventure-readiness with unique tires, off-road suspension, and driver-assist features like Crawl Control. The Sequoia's maximum towing capacity was 4,137 kilograms, with several towing-related upgrades available.

Form and function

2024 Lincoln Nautilus

9/10

2024 Toyota Sequoia

5/10

The 2024 Lincoln Nautilus offered power-adjustable, heated, and cooled front seats, with the 24-way Perfect Position front seats providing exceptional comfort. The rear seats, while not as luxurious, offered 1,095 millimetres of legroom, accommodating taller passengers comfortably. The Lincoln Rejuvenate feature combined massage, lighting, and screen images to create different moods. Cargo space was generous, with 997 litres behind the second row and 1,947 litres with the seats folded down. The Nautilus was available only with seating for five, prioritizing cargo space over additional seating.

The 2024 Toyota Sequoia featured automatic power-deploying running boards on the Capstone and Platinum trims, aiding entry for shorter passengers. The Sequoia offered a maximum of 2,460 litres of cargo space with both second- and third-row seats folded. The third-row seats, positioned above the hybrid powertrain's battery pack, did not create a flat load floor when folded. Headroom was slightly reduced, and legroom varied across rows. Second-row captain's chairs were available on higher trims, providing comfort but lacking bolstering. The Sequoia's interior focused on practicality, with ample space for passengers and cargo.

Technology

2024 Lincoln Nautilus

8/10

2024 Toyota Sequoia

8/10

The 2024 Lincoln Nautilus featured a stunning 48-inch curved display, with customizable sections for weather, audio, and trip information. An 11.1-inch touchscreen handled basic infotainment duties, with wireless Apple CarPlay and Android Auto connectivity. HVAC controls were accessible via permanent icons, though vent adjustments required navigating menus. Unlabelled steering wheel controls were a distraction, but the inclusion of Google Maps, Alexa Built-in, and over-the-air updates added convenience. Wireless charging and USB ports were standard throughout the cabin.

The 2024 Toyota Sequoia's Capstone trim boasted a 14-inch centre touchscreen, with wireless Apple CarPlay and Android Auto standard across all trims. The Toyota Audio Multimedia infotainment system prioritized functionality over flashiness. A full-colour 12.3-inch driver information display was standard, and the Panoramic View monitor was included on higher trims. A 10-inch colour head-up display was standard on Capstone, and a 14-speaker JBL Premium Audio system was available on Limited and standard on Platinum and Capstone.

Safety

2024 Lincoln Nautilus

9/10

2024 Toyota Sequoia

10/10

The 2024 Lincoln Nautilus came equipped with the Lincoln CoPilot 360 suite of ADAS features, including lane-keeping assist, park assist, adaptive cruise control, blind-spot monitoring, and emergency braking. Blue Cruise 1.2 technology offered hands-free driving on pre-mapped highways, with features like automatic lane-change assist and In-Lane Repositioning. The 2024 Nautilus had not yet been rated by the NHTSA, but the 2023 model received high scores for crash protection. The IIHS rated the 2024 Nautilus "Good" in crashworthiness.

The 2024 Toyota Sequoia featured the Toyota Safety Sense (TSS) 2.5 suite of safety and driver-assistance features as standard. This included a pre-collision system with pedestrian detection, lane-departure alert with steering assist, adaptive cruise control, and road-sign recognition. Front and rear parking sensors with automatic braking and blind-spot monitoring with rear cross-traffic alert were also standard. The only optional driver aid was a trailer backup guide with Straight-Path Assist. The 2024 Sequoia had not yet been rated by the IIHS or NHTSA, but the similar 2024 Toyota Tundra earned a Top Safety Pick+ designation.
